Direct Flights

The quickest way to get from New York to Dubai is by taking a direct flight. Several airlines offer non-stop flights between the two cities, including Emirates, Delta, and United. The duration of a direct flight from New York to Dubai is approximately 12 hours and 30 minutes.

Layover Flights

If you’re looking for cheaper options or more flexible schedules, you may consider taking a layover flight. Many airlines offer connecting flights that stop at other airports before reaching Dubai. Some common layover cities include London, Paris, Istanbul, and Doha.

The total duration of a layover flight depends on the length of each layover and the time spent in transit. On average, a one-stop flight from New York to Dubai takes about 16-20 hours. However, this can vary significantly depending on the airline and route chosen.

Tips for Long Flights

Regardless of whether you choose a direct or layover flight, long-haul flights can be exhausting. Here are some tips to make your journey more comfortable:

  • Stay hydrated: Drink plenty of water throughout your flight to combat dehydration.
  • Dress comfortably: Wear loose-fitting clothes and comfortable shoes.
  • Bring entertainment: Pack books, magazines or download movies on your tablet.
  • Move around: Take regular walks around the cabin to stretch your legs and prevent blood clots.
  • Adjust to time zones: Try to sleep or stay awake according to the local time at your destination.
